    摘要:

    第四纪红色粘土母质发育起来的黄壤性水稻土,二十多年来大量施用磷肥,磷在耕层富集.耕层全磷含量平均0.048%,有效磷含量平均11.6ppm,分别比底土层高1.7倍和7.5倍,比荒地表层高2.1倍和28.4倍.黄壤性水稻土无机磷形态为混合分布型,Al-P、Fe-P、Ca-P、O-P分别占无机磷总量的5.9%,30.6%,28.7%和34.8%.小麦、水稻分蘖期测定的A值与产量和植株吸磷量相关,能表示土壤磷素有效性的高低.A值与土壤Fe-P和Ca-P相关,表明这两种磷酸盐是稻麦的主要磷源.Olsen法可作为测定黄壤性水稻士有效磷含量的标准方法.

    Abstract:

    The paddy soil from Quaternary red clay is generally deficient in P.Owing to phosphate fertilizer having been successively applied for more than 20 years, P is concentrated in topsoil in which the total P is 0.048%, and the available P is 11.6 ppm on the average.It is 1.7 times and 7.5 times higher than those in subsoil, and 2.1 times and 28.4 times higher than those in topsoil of waste soil with scarce vegetation respectively.The distribution of various fractions of P in the paddy soils was closely related with the zonality of main soil group on which the paddy soils were developers.The orpanic P was about 35.4%.The Al-p, Ca-p, Fe-p and O-p were about 5.9%, 30.6%, 28.7% and 34.8% respectively.The organic P and non-occluded P increased after rice season under submerged condition, while they decreased afterwheat season in dry farming.
